Heritage turkeys are known for their natural beauty, active personalities, and traditional farmyard appearance. Unlike broad breasted varieties, these breeds can naturally reproduce, forage well, and thrive in free-range environments. Turkeys aren’t the first animal people think of as a pet, but they definitely deserve a spot on the list! They’re social, interactive, and often more people-focused than you’d expect from a backyard bird. Some are bold and curious, others are calm and observant, and those personalities can vary by breed and individual.
Many will choose to be near you, follow you around, or simply hang out while you’re outside. They also tend to mix well with other poultry when given enough space, though they definitely bring a bigger presence to the flock.
Things to keep in mind:
Plan for at least 75–100 sq ft per turkey in an outdoor run (more is always better)
Indoor shelter should allow about 4–6 sq ft per bird
They can be vocal, especially as they mature
They require consistent care and a clean, secure setup
Turkeys are a great fit for people looking for birds with personality, purpose, and presence. If you’ve got the space and enjoy hands-on animals, they can easily become one of the most rewarding birds you raise.
Black Spanish turkeys are one of the oldest heritage breeds, known for their striking black feathers with a metallic sheen. Hardy and excellent foragers, they thrive in free-range setups and offer both quality meat and reliable egg production. Calm and easy to handle.
Blue Slate turkeys stand out with their slate-blue feathers, ranging from light gray to deep smoky tones. This hardy, calm breed is well-suited for free-range living and known for its strong foraging ability. With flavorful meat and reliable egg production, they’re a great dual-purpose choice.
Narragansett turkeys are a historic, eye-catching breed with a mix of black, gray, tan, and white feathers. Calm, hardy, and easy to handle, they do well in both free-range and managed setups. Known for strong foraging, steady egg production, and quality meat, they’re a reliable, low-maintenance choice for any flock.
Standard Bronze turkeys are a classic heritage breed, known for their striking metallic bronze feathers and impressive size. Hardy and excellent foragers, they thrive in free-range environments and offer both flavorful meat and reliable egg production, making them a strong, traditional choice for any flock.
Broad Breasted White turkeys are the industry standard for size, growth, and meat production. Bred for rapid growth and high yield, they reach market weight quickly and deliver large, meaty carcasses. A top choice for both backyard growers and commercial production, they’re ideal for holiday tables and high-efficiency meat production.
Broad-Breasted Bronze turkeys are fast-growing birds known for their high meat yield and classic, wild turkey appearance. They’re a popular choice for both small farms and commercial growers. They were bred from Bronze-type stock for larger size and more breast meat than heritage Standard Bronze turkeys. Unlike heritage turkeys, they are not intended to be kept as a pet or for breeding and are primarily raised for efficient meat production.
